Chapter 13 - The Photo (Part 2)

As weddings go, this was a nice one.

The brutal afternoon heat had broken and there was now a refreshing breeze coming off the ocean. The guests sat comfortably on padded folding chairs, enjoying the serenity of the gentle surf and the blissful absence of children under sixteen, who were pointedly not invited.

Standing in relief against the shimmering silver waters of the Pacific, Robyn and Brian faced each other, beaming, under a trellis archway draped with purple wisteria. Brian looked dapper in his tuxedo, and Robyn was the quintessence of elegance, her veil seeming to glow as the orange sun caressed the sea.

In short, it was a perfectly acceptable place for two people to begin their lives together.

Robyn tried to absorb it all, but everything went by so fast. The earnest vows, the solemn exchange of rings, the first marital kiss that went on and on until everyone laughed. The party. An unsteady, unrehearsed, but adorable first dance. A drunken, rambling toast by the Best Man. "Celebration" by Kool & The Gang, as required by federal law. And finally, a dash to the limousine under a shower of bird seed. And then it was over.

It was all an indistinct blur. Except for one part, early on, which Robyn would remember with crystal clarity for the rest of her life. It was her entrance. The Bridal Chorus began, the combination of flute and harp infusing Wagner's well-worn notes with a sublime, ethereal quality. Then she took her father's arm and he led her down the aisle.

The assembled guests stood and turned to face her. They had all been to plenty of weddings, but clearly, they were not prepared for this vision of pure loveliness before them. They shared a collective gasp that dissolved into excited, private whispers of astonishment and envy. 

Even Julia, who almost boycotted the event out a sense of obligation to her suffragette foremothers, was moved practically to tears by Robyn's beauty. Swept away by emotion, and not knowing what else to do, she clutched the hand of her Plus 1, brought it to her lips and kissed it several times.

Robyn smiled beatifically as she walked down the aisle with measured, self-assured steps. And when Brian finally saw her, he uttered a silent prayer to the heavens, thanking God for making him too selfish and weak a person to rush to her rescue when he should have.

When Robyn got to the front, her father lifted her veil, gave her a peck on the cheek, and sat down. And in that moment, she stood there alone, her hands at her waist, hidden behind a white orchid bouquet. Out of the corner of her eye, she saw the photographer and she smiled into the lens. There was a flash. The photographer looked at the image on the LCD screen and, from his immensely satisfied look, Robyn knew she had what she wanted.

The bridal picture. The timeless portrait of a woman at her happiest, her most beautiful. Life is fleeting, Robyn knew. Some day her body would deteriorate, her health would fail, and ultimately the earth would reclaim her. But there would always be a picture of her on this joyous day. Happy, radiant and in love.
